Oct 21, In older telephone installations, the phone cable typically has four small-gauge wires inside the outer jacket: red, green, black, and yellow. The wire insulation should just touch the screw terminal and there should be no excess bare wire extending out from the screw. To make the wire connections, loosen each terminal screw with a screwdriver. Wrap the bare copper end of the wire around the screw in a clockwise direction, using needle-nose pliers. Tighten the screw to secure the wire. The RJ uses four wires and it's used to handle two lines, or 2-line phones. Then, identify the individual wires you'll be using: Old four-wire cable: Line 1 (primary phone line): red and green Line 2 (secondary line): black and yellow Cat-3 or Cat-5 cable: Line 1 (primary phone line): blue and white-with-blue-stripe. A second pair of wires is used if you are installing a second line, such as a second voice-phone line. Loosen the screws on the 2 blue terminals, wrap the bare wires of the blue wire pair around the terminal. To wire surface telephone jacks—those fastened to the wall surface—remove the jack cover to expose the terminals. For screw-type terminals, strip about 3/8" of the sheathing from the wire. Loosen the screws that secure the red, green, yellow and black telephone wires. radius; smooth, gradual ones are best to protect the wire. Pull gently on cables when feeding them through holes and tight spaces. Avoid tight bends of less than 2-in. Clamp cables to framing with nylon cable straps, lightly secured around the cables and screwed to the framing. Never compress, crush or deform the wire.
